Modern Elegance: Crafting a Contemporary House Interior

Designing a contemporary house interior involves embracing sleek lines, innovative materials, and a focus on open spaces. Join us on a journey to explore the key elements that define modern elegance within the realm of contemporary interior design.

1. Open Floor Plans: Seamless Integration

Opt for open floor plans to seamlessly integrate living spaces. Removing unnecessary walls enhances the flow between rooms, creating a sense of spaciousness and connectivity.

2. Neutral Color Palette: Timeless Sophistication

Choose a neutral color palette as the foundation of contemporary interiors. Whites, greys, and muted tones create a timeless backdrop, allowing furniture and design elements to take center stage.

3. Clean Lines: Streamlined Aesthetics

Embrace clean lines for streamlined aesthetics. From furniture to architectural details, a focus on straight lines and geometric shapes contributes to the sleek and contemporary feel.

4. Innovative Materials: Cutting-Edge Finishes

Incorporate innovative materials and cutting-edge finishes. Stainless steel, glass, concrete, and polished surfaces add a touch of modernity, creating a visually striking and sophisticated atmosphere.

5. Minimalist Furniture: Functional Simplicity

Opt for minimalist furniture with functional simplicity. Choose pieces that serve a purpose without unnecessary ornamentation, contributing to an uncluttered and refined interior.

6. Statement Lighting: Artistic Illumination

Integrate statement lighting fixtures as artistic focal points. Contemporary chandeliers, pendant lights, and unique fixtures not only illuminate spaces but also add a touch of artistry.

7. Large Windows: Abundant Natural Light

Design spaces with large windows to invite abundant natural light. The connection with the outdoors enhances the contemporary feel and contributes to a bright and airy ambiance.

8. Open Shelving: Displaying Design Elements

Incorporate open shelving to display design elements. From art pieces to curated collections, open shelves add a personal touch and create visual interest in contemporary interiors.

9. Functional Artwork: Expressive Decor

Choose functional artwork as expressive decor. Sculptures, abstract paintings, and art installations serve both aesthetic and functional purposes, becoming integral elements of the contemporary design.

10. Technology Integration: Smart Home Features

Integrate smart home features and technology. From automated lighting systems to smart thermostats, incorporating modern technology enhances the functionality and efficiency of contemporary living.

11. Bold Accents: Pops of Color

Introduce bold accents for pops of color. Vibrant throw pillows, statement furniture pieces, or accent walls add visual interest and break the monotony of neutral tones.

12. Comfortable Textures: Warmth in Design

Infuse comfortable textures for warmth in design. Plush rugs, soft cushions, and textured fabrics provide a counterbalance to the clean lines, adding a layer of comfort to contemporary interiors.
